Embed - Definition

Embed is a term used to describe an object, software, or hardware that is independent and does not need an external program or device to run it. For instance, in Web page design, one can link to or insert a video image or sound file into the page so that it is hyperlinked and clickable. When click on, the video image or sound file is played as the operation system usually contains a built-in multimedia application to play it.
